The Story Behind Shriyan
Shriyan is a name with deep roots in Sanskrit, an ancient Indo-Aryan language. The word 'Shri' (เคถเฅเคฐเฅ) itself is a highly revered term in Hinduism, signifying wealth, prosperity, auspiciousness, and divinity. It is often used as an honorific prefix for deities, especially Lakshmi (goddess of wealth) and Vishnu. The suffix '-yan' can denote 'going' or 'path', or simply be an augmentative or adjectival ending, further emphasizing the qualities of 'Shri'.
The name is primarily associated with Lord Vishnu, one of the principal deities of Hinduism, revered as the Preserver of the universe. This association imbues the name with a sense of divine blessing, protection, and grandeur. Its usage reflects a cultural preference for names that carry positive spiritual and material connotations, wishing prosperity and well-being upon the bearer.
